The gene inflated is referred to in FlyBase by the symbol if (CG9623, FBgn0001250). It has the cytological map location 15A5-15A7. Its sequence location is X:16646222..16677467. Its molecular function is described as: cell adhesion molecule binding; receptor activity; protein binding. It is involved in the biological processes described with 17 unique terms, many of which group under: anatomical structure development; cell adhesion; open tracheal system development; cell motility; organ development; cell-cell adhesion; organ morphogenesis; maintenance of protein localization; cell-substrate adhesion; heterophilic cell adhesion; imaginal disc-derived wing margin morphogenesis; macromolecule localization; muscle cell differentiation; gut development; regulation of cell morphogenesis. 77 alleles are reported. The phenotypes of these alleles are annotated with 43 unique terms, many of which group under: organ system; hypodermal muscle of larval abdomen; primordium; adult segment; embryonic nervous system; larval abdominal segment 5; adult mesothoracic segment; larval abdominal segment; nervous system; abdominal 7 longitudinal muscle. It has 2 annotated transcripts and 2 annotated polypeptides.

hide Phenotypic Description from the Red Book (Lindsley & Zimm 1992)
Gene/Allele symbols may differ from current usage
if: inflated
Structural gene for the α-subunit of position specific integrin 2 (PS2), a large transmembrane protein (Bogaert et al., 1987). The β-subunit can associate with either of the two α-subunits, PS1 or PS2 (Brower et al., 1984; Wilcox, Brown, Piovant, Smith, and White, 1984, EMBO J. 3: 2307-13). Both α and β integrin are expressed in embryonic and larval tissues. In early development, PS2 is found in the mesoderm, localized to muscle attachments (Bogaert et al., 1987). Later, PS1 is expressed in the presumptive dorsal epithelium of the third instar imaginal wing discs; also, PS2 is found in the ventral epithelium, both integrins being important for the joining of the dorsal and ventral surfaces of the wing blade (Brower and Jaffe, 1989). Null mutations cause embryonic lethality (Wilcox, DiAntonio, and Leptin). In the mutant if1, the adult wing is inflated with lymph and smaller than normal; venation is defective. Wings later become dry and blistered.
if3
Longitudinal veins thickened, especially at wing base. Anterior crossvein thickened. if3/if3 flies show reduced levels of PS2 integrin on the surfaces of some imaginal disc cells (especially in the ventral region), but levels of this integrin in muscle, salivary glands, and most other tissues seem to be normal (Brower and Jaffe, 1989). Adult wings typically show large round wing blisters, but the penetrance of this phenotype in homo- and hemizygotes is variable. if3/ifk27e flies show an increase in penetrance (from 15-20% in homozygotes to 60-70% in the heteroalleles); penetrance is reduced in if3/ifk27e flies by low temperature and crowding (Brower and Jaffe, 1989).
